tp官方下载安卓最新版本2024|tp官网下载/tp安卓版下载/Tpwallet官方最新版|TP官方网址下载
TP怎么查看价格:系统性分析与未来评估
一、合约集成:决定“从哪里取价、如何取价”
要查看TP价格,首先要明确价格来源与取价路径。合约集成通常包含三部分:价格发布合约、查询/聚合接口、以及前端或服务端的调用逻辑。
1)价格发布机制
- 可能由链上喂价合约(Oracle)提供,也可能由交易所/流动性池派生。
- 常见方式是:价格由特定更新周期写入链上状态变量,或由事件日志(Event)触发更新。
2)查询与聚合
- 直接读取合约状态(如 read-only 方法)。
- 或通过聚合器将多个来源汇总(如加权平均、取中位数、价格区间过滤)。
3)取价一致性与时间戳
- 价格并非永远“最新”,需要检查更新时间:例如 roundId、lastUpdated、blockNumber。
- 系统应暴露给调用方:当前价格、延迟、更新轮次,避免误用“过期价格”。
二、高科技生态系统:影响价格“可见性”和“可用性”
TP价格查看不只取决于合约,还受其所在的高科技生态系统影响。生态系统的关键包括:
1)链与跨链生态
- 同一TP可能存在不同网络(主网/测试网/侧链),价格口径可能不同。
- 若存在跨链桥或跨域消息传递,取价时要确认对应网络与结算规则。
2)数据提供方与服务层
- 生态中可能有数据索引服务(Indexer)、价格聚合服务、或图数据服务。
- 指标口径(如是否包含手续费、滑点估计、净价/毛价)必须对齐。
3)缓存与订阅机制
- 为提升性能,系统可能做本地缓存或订阅式更新。
- 取价时应明确:读取的是链上最终态,还是缓存态;订阅回调是否存在丢包或乱序问题。
三、数据恢复:防止“价格看错”与“缺失不可用”
数据恢复是查看TP价格时的隐性保障,尤其在以下场景中:节点重启、索引服务故障、链上重组(Reorg)、网络抖动。
1)链上重放与回补策略
- 索引服务应支持从某个区块高度重新扫描并回补数据。
- 使用“检查点(checkpoint)+ 回溯窗口(rewind window)”来对抗短暂链重组。
2)幂等写入与一致性
- 恢复过程要保证幂等性:重复处理同一事件不会造成重复写入或价格偏移。
- 对价格聚合结果同样要可重算,避免恢复后出现“历史与当前口径不一致”。
3)降级读取
- 当实时数据不可用时,可以切换到最近一次可靠数据,并标注“数据新鲜度”。
- 对外提供明确状态:online/offline、freshness、confidence。
四、分布式系统设计:让“取价服务”稳定可扩展
TP价格查看通常不是单一模块完成,而是分布式系统设计的产物。
1)服务分层
- 采集层:从链上节点、索引器、或外部行情源抓取数据。
- 处理层:进行清洗、校验、聚合与口径转换。
- 查询层:对外提供API(HTTP/WS/gRPC)或前端可读接口。
2)一致性与容错
- 使用超时、重试、熔断(circuit breaker)、负载均衡(LB)。
- 对聚合算法引入容错:某些源异常不应导致整体不可用。
3)可观测性(Observability)
- 指标:延迟(latency)、失败率(error rate)、数据新鲜度(freshness)。
- 日志与追踪:便于定位“取价错误是来自链上、索引器还是聚合服务”。
五、安全测试:确保价格查询“可信、抗攻击”
价格查看系统尤其容易成为攻击入口,例如数据投毒(data poisoning)、回放攻击(replay)、中间人篡改(MITM),以及错误合约调用。
1)合约层安全
- 检查喂价合约的更新权限与访问控制(owner/multisig/role-based)。
- 测试异常路径:更新失败、越权写入、价格大幅跳变限制。
2)传输与鉴权
- API调用应使用鉴权(token、签名、mTLS),并启用HTTPS/TLS。
- 对WebSocket等长连接要防止会话劫持与重放。
3)安全测试方法
- 单元测试:合约读取与聚合逻辑的边界条件。


- 集成测试:模拟链上事件、回滚、网络抖动。
- 模糊测试(Fuzzing):对输入参数、回调数据格式、解析逻辑做健壮性测试。
4)性能与安全联动
- 防止DoS导致价格服务不可用:限流(rate limit)、队列治理(queue governance)。
六、市场未来评估:TP价格走势的“系统性判断框架”
查看价格只是第一步,更关键是对未来做评估。市场未来评估可采用“数据驱动 + 结构性因素”的组合。
1)流动性与交易结构
- 观察交易深度、滑点变化、买卖价差(spread)。
- 若流动性不足,价格波动将放大,价格“可见但不可用”。
2)供需与生态增长
- 关注生态中集成数量、用户增长、合约采用度。
- 如果TP与某些应用绑定(手续费、燃烧机制、激励机制),则需求与价值传导可能增强。
3)风险因素与监管/协议变更
- 协议升级、参数调整、费率变化都会影响价格口径与波动。
- 对外部政策与合规风险做情景分析(base/bull/bear)。
4)情景与指标
- 以“价格驱动因素”建立指标:真实成交量、活跃地址、资金流向、波动率、预期收益。
- 通过历史回测与压力测试,评估未来区间而非单点预测。
七、节点验证:确保价格读取来源“确实可靠”
节点验证用于保证读取到的数据来自可信节点与可信链状态。
1)多节点交叉验证
- 对关键价格可进行多RPC节点对比:同一查询是否返回一致。
- 若存在差异,触发告警与降级读取策略。
2)区块确认与最终性
- 价格依赖的区块需要一定确认数(confirmations)以降低重组风险。
- 对“最后更新时间”进行一致性判断:更新时间不能落后于预期窗口。
3)校验数据一致性
- 对事件日志与合约状态的关联性进行校验。
- 若聚合器计算结果与源数据推导不一致,标记为异常并回滚使用旧值或切换策略。
结语:一套可落地的TP价格查看体系
综合以上要点,TP价格查看可以归纳为:
- 合约集成:确定价格来源、口径与时间戳;
- 高科技生态系统:对齐链路与数据服务;
- 数据恢复:保证故障后仍能正确取值;
- 分布式系统设计:提供稳定可扩展的查询能力;
- 安全测试:防止价格被篡改或误用;
- 市场未来评估:把“看价格”升级为“评估与决策”;
- 节点验证:确保来源可信、状态最终。
如果你告诉我:你要查看的TP具体是哪个网络/合约地址,以及你希望看到的是“链上合约价格”“交易所行情价”还是“聚合后的现货参考价”,我可以把上述框架进一步落成明确的步骤清单与接口/字段示例。
评论